"HIGHLIGHTS
At the end of December 2009, there were 9.1 million active internet subscribers in Australia.
The phasing out of dial-up internet connections continued with nearly 90% of internet connections now being non dial-up. Australians also continued to access higher download speeds, with 62% of access connections having a download speed of 1.5Mbps or greater.
Digital subscriber line (DSL) continued to be the major technology for connections, accounting for 51% of non dial-up connections. However, this percentage share has decreased since June 2009 when DSL represented 57% of non dial-up connections.
Mobile wireless via a datacard, dongle or USB modem was the fastest growing technology in internet connections, increasing to 2.8 million in December 2009. This represents a 40% increase from June 2009."
"8153.0 - Internet Activity, Australia, Dec 2009 Quality Declaration Latest ISSUE Released at 11:30 AM (CANBERRA TIME) 30/03/2010"
